ingredients
3 pounds corned beef, with packet
1 cup water (adjust depending on slow cooker size)
3 cloves garlic, minced
1 bay leaf
2 tablespoons sugar
2 tablespoons cider vinegar
½ teaspoon ground black pepper

directions
- Place the corned beef in the slow cooker, fat side up.
- Add the minced garlic, bay leaf, sugar, cider vinegar, and ground black pepper to the slow cooker.
- Pour in 1 cup of water, or just enough to cover the bottom of the slow cooker without submerging the beef entirely.
- Cover and cook on low for 8 to 10 hours, or until the beef is tender.
- Once cooked, remove the beef and place it on a baking sheet lined with foil.
- Preheat your oven’s broiler.
- Broil the corned beef for 5 to 7 minutes until the surface becomes crispy and caramelized. Watch closely to prevent burning.
- Let the corned beef rest for 10 minutes before slicing and serving.

Variations
- Add peeled carrots, potatoes, and cabbage to the slow cooker during the last 2 hours of cooking for a complete meal.
- Use brown sugar instead of white sugar for a deeper sweetness.
- Add whole peppercorns and mustard seeds from the seasoning packet for extra flavor.
- For a tangier flavor, increase the cider vinegar by 1 tablespoon.
- Serve with classic mustard or horseradish sauce.
storage/reheating
Store leftover corned beef tightly wrapped in the refrigerator for up to 4 days. Reheat gently in the oven or microwave until warmed through. Avoid overheating to maintain juiciness. Leftovers can also be sliced thin and used in sandwiches.
FAQs
Can I cook corned beef without the seasoning packet?
Yes, but the seasoning packet adds traditional flavor. You can substitute with your own blend of pickling spices.
How do I know when the corned beef is done?
The meat should be fork-tender and easily pierced with a knife.
Can I cook this in an Instant Pot?
Yes, pressure cook for about 90 minutes on high, followed by natural release.
Is it necessary to broil the beef?
No, but broiling adds a desirable crispy crust and caramelization.
Can I add vegetables during cooking?
Yes, add vegetables like carrots and potatoes during the last 2 hours of slow cooking.
How much water should I use?
Just enough to cover the bottom of the slow cooker; corned beef releases its own juices during cooking.
Can I use leftover corned beef for other dishes?
Absolutely, it’s great in sandwiches, hash, or tacos.
What sides pair well with corned beef?
Classic sides include cabbage, boiled potatoes, and mustard sauce.
Can I freeze leftover corned beef?
Yes, freeze in airtight containers for up to 3 months.
Is this recipe gluten-free?
Yes, all ingredients used are naturally gluten-free.
